Respect our Roads!

by isleofman.com 14th May 2013

The message to bikers heading to the Isle of Man for TT this month is Respect Our Roads!

That slogan will front the annual road safety campaign for the festival, launched yesterday by the Department of Infrastructure and police.

For the first time the campaign is endorsed by current riders, with local TT stars Conor Cummins and Dave Molyneux backing efforts to reduce casualties over the fortnight.

Leaflets and banners will soon appear urging all drivers - resident and visiting - to drive responsibly and stay safe by respecting the roads.

Infrastructure minister David Cretney hopes the rider endorsement will 'hit the spot' among fans:
